6. Ranking
6.1. Results in the Oftet platform search are ranked according to the date of publication of the Advertisement, the Candidate's CV and/or CV video (the most recent Advertisements, Candidates' CVs and/or CV videos are displayed first), except where a paid content promotion service is applied to specific content.

9. Intellectual Property Rights
9.1. The structure of the Oftet platform and its content and individual elements thereof (texts, graphics, drawings, images, audio and video material, trademarks, logos, domains, know-how, computer programs, databases, etc. published by Oftet) (hereinafter – Oftet content) are the property of Oftet or its licensors, protected under applicable law, and all intellectual property rights in Oftet content belong to Oftet or its licensors.
9.2. Any full or partial copying and/or reproduction and/or publication and/or modification and/or adaptation and/or decompilation and/or encryption and/or any distribution and/or use of Oftet content available on the Oftet platform for any purpose other than that provided for in this clause, regardless of the manner in which it is done, is strictly prohibited without the prior written consent of Oftet or the licensors of its elements. Oftet content is exclusively of an informational nature and may be used only for employee search. The prohibition set out in this clause shall not apply to the User's Advertisements and other information published by the User in respect of which intellectual property rights belong to the User.
9.3. By using the Oftet platform, the User grants Oftet, free of charge, for an indefinite period (or for the maximum applicable term of the relevant rights if limited), worldwide, a non-exclusive, transferable, sublicensable licence to reproduce, copy, digitise, store, accumulate in databases, systematise, adapt, edit, translate, publish, publicly display, distribute and make publicly available via the internet or other electronic communication networks the Advertisement and any other content published by the User on the Oftet platform, including but not limited to Advertisements, in any manner and form. The User confirms that they have all rights and authorisations to grant Oftet the licence specified in this clause of the Rules.
9.4. No remuneration shall be paid to the User for the use of the Advertisement and/or other content submitted by the User under the licence provided for in Clause 9.3 of the Rules, unless the Parties expressly agree otherwise in writing.
9.5. The User understands and agrees that, by using the Oftet platform, they do not acquire any rights to Oftet content and may use it only in accordance with these Rules.

11. Liability
11.1. The Parties shall be liable for failure to perform the obligations provided for in these Rules in accordance with the Rules and/or applicable law. Under these Rules and to the extent permitted by applicable law, Oftet shall be liable only for direct losses actually incurred by the User due to Oftet's fault; however, in any event Oftet's liability shall not exceed 5 000 Eur.
11.2. The User clearly understands that Oftet is responsible only for the technical posting of an Advertisement on the Oftet platform if it complies with the requirements of the Rules; however, Oftet shall in no way be responsible for the content of the Advertisement and/or other information submitted by the User or its compliance with the Rules and/or applicable law. Only the User shall be responsible for Advertisements and/or other information submitted by the User and published on the Oftet platform.
11.3. The User clearly understands that the Oftet platform operates "as is", i.e. without any confirmations or warranties from Oftet that the Oftet platform will operate uninterruptedly and/or without errors or disruptions. Oftet shall in no way be responsible for internet access services.
11.4. Oftet shall in no way be responsible for the unlawfulness, inaccuracy or falsity of Advertisements and/or other information submitted by the User and posted on the Oftet platform and for negative consequences arising therefrom for the User and/or Third Parties.
11.5. A User who infringes the intellectual property rights of Oftet, other Users and/or Third Parties must compensate for losses incurred as a result of such infringement in accordance with applicable law.
11.6. Oftet shall be exempt from any liability in cases where the User suffers losses because the User has not actually familiarised themselves with these Rules, the Privacy Policy and/or information provided on the Oftet platform, even though they were given the opportunity to do so.
11.7. The Parties shall not be liable for partial or complete failure to perform their obligations if they prove that they failed to perform obligations due to force majeure circumstances. Force majeure circumstances shall be understood as defined in the applicable laws of the Republic of Lithuania. The Party that, due to force majeure circumstances, is unable to perform its obligations must notify the other Party in writing immediately, but no later than within 3 (three) days from the day such circumstances arose or became known.
